In 1967 Malcolm Smith heard about a race that would run all the way down the Baja Peninsula in Mexico, and was just crazy enough to think it was a great idea. If that was the only great thing he ever did, it would arguably be enough, but when he went, raced, and won that first Baja 1000, we’re pretty sure he had no idea just how big his career would be. With 5 more Baja 1000 wins, splitting his 6 evenly between cars and bikes, Malcolm is a certifiable Baja Legend.

In this interview he talks about how his wife is a private pilot and that they fly over Baja in search of new trails, new roads, and new fun all the time. We’re jealous, if for no other reason than the fact that running Baja is a true dream of mine.
